Things to Do & See in Moldova
Explore local wineries and enjoy wine tastings
Discover world-famous underground cellars at Cricova and Milestii Mici, visit Castel Mimi for a château-style experience, or enjoy boutique wineries such as Asconi and Et Cetera.
Discover traditional Moldovan cuisine
Taste local specialties like sarmale (stuffed cabbage rolls), mămăligă with cheese and sour cream, plăcinte, and homemade desserts paired with local wine.
Take a walk through Chișinău’s parks and city center
Stroll along Stefan cel Mare Boulevard, relax in Stefan cel Mare Central Park, enjoy lake views at Valea Morilor, or explore the city’s lively streets and squares.
Visit museums such as the National Museum of History, the National Museum of Ethnography, or local art galleries.
